Dragon Copilot Implementation Considerations for Health Systems:

1. Workflow Changes & physician Adaptation:

Patient Consent: Physicians will need to obtain patient permission to record conversations.
reduced Direct computer Dependency: Clinicians will shift from extensive manual typing to reviewing and editing transcriptions. this requires adapting to a new way of documenting.
Focus on Review and accuracy: The primary role of the physician will be to ensure the accuracy and completeness of the transcribed notes, rather than creating them from scratch.

2. IT & EHR Integration:

EHR Team readiness: The IT EHR team must be prepared for the integration of Dragon Copilot.
EHR as the Central Hub: The primary value of Dragon Copilot lies in its ability to reduce documentation time within the EHR. Seamless integration is crucial.

3. Phased Implementation & Adoption:

Targeting Early Adopters: Primary care and family care physicians are suggested as good starting points due to their potential for faster adoption.
Starting Small: A phased approach allows for testing and refinement to understand what works best for a general physician population.
Specialist Considerations: Specialists may initially require more corrections. Refined models are expected to improve performance for them over time.4. Customization & Tailoring of Output:

Post-Visit Tailoring: Dragon Copilot offers versatility in how summarized notes are presented after a patient visit.
Style Preferences: Physicians can customize notes to be verbose or concise, and clinically oriented or written in layman’s terms.
parameter Management: While numerous customization options exist, achieving the desired output may require time and planning.

5. Security, governance & AI Standards:

Microsoft Ecosystem Benefits: Integration with the Microsoft ecosystem can improve login and downstream activities.
microsoft Security & AI standards: Microsoft products adhere to high security levels and a Responsible AI Standard.
Internal Review: Organizations should still subject Dragon Copilot to their own AI and data governance committees for an additional layer of review.

In essence, successful Dragon Copilot implementation hinges on preparing clinicians for workflow shifts, ensuring smooth IT integration with the EHR, considering a strategic rollout, planning for customization, and maintaining robust security and governance practices.

understanding Dragon Copilot’s Core Capabilities

Dragon Copilot isn’t a replacement for clinicians, but an augmentation of their abilities. it’s built upon decades of experience in speech-to-text technology and now incorporates advanced AI features.Hear’s a breakdown of its key functionalities:

Ambient Listening: Captures the natural flow of patient-physician conversations, automatically generating draft notes. This minimizes the need for manual dictation and allows doctors to focus on the patient.

Automated Chart Summarization: Quickly synthesizes lengthy patient histories, lab results, and previous notes into concise, actionable summaries. This is invaluable for swift patient handoffs and informed decision-making.

Smart Templates & Macros: Pre-populated templates for common diagnoses and procedures, coupled with customizable macros, accelerate documentation and ensure consistency. Think standardized discharge summaries and progress notes.

Real-time Feedback & Learning: The AI continuously learns from user corrections and preferences, improving accuracy and personalization over time.

Integration with EHR Systems: Seamlessly integrates with leading Electronic Health Record (EHR) systems like Epic, Cerner, and Allscripts, ensuring data flows smoothly and avoids duplication.

Practical Tips for Successful Implementation

implementing Dragon Copilot requires careful planning and execution. Here are some key considerations:

  1. Pilot Program: Start with a pilot program in a specific department to assess the technology’s impact and gather user feedback.
  2. Comprehensive Training: Provide thorough training to all users on how to effectively utilize Dragon Copilot’s features.
  3. Customization: Customize templates and macros to align with specific departmental workflows and preferences.
  4. EHR Integration: Ensure seamless integration with your existing EHR system.
  5. Ongoing Monitoring & Optimization: Continuously monitor performance and make adjustments as needed to optimize results.
  6. Data Security & Compliance: Prioritize data security and ensure compliance with HIPAA regulations.
